For those that might not know, the version of Rambo: Last Blood we got here in the States was 12 minutes shorter than the version released elsewhere in the world. But fear not, today we learned the extended / international cut is now available on Amazon Prime Video.

It centers on the Vietnam War veteran trying to find some semblance of peace by raising horses on a ranch in Arizona. He’s also developed a special familial bond with a woman named Maria and her teenage granddaughter Gabriela. But when a vicious Mexican cartel kidnaps Gabriela, Rambo crosses the border on a bloody and personal quest to rescue her and punish those responsible.
Rated R for strong graphic violence, grisly images, drug use and language, it has 27% on Rotten Tomatoes with this Critics Consensus: Like the sequels that preceded it, Rambo: Last Blood is content to indulge in bloody violence at the expense of its main character’s once-poignant story.
